Storage Conditions for Semaglutide

The manufacturer’s instructions and regulatory guidelines specify that semaglutide should be stored in the refrigerator at a temperature between 2°C and 8°C (36°F and 46°F) until its expiration date or the date specified on the packaging, whichever comes first. This requirement is not unique to semaglutide; many injectable medications, especially biologics, require refrigeration to maintain their stability and potency. The cold temperature helps to slow down the degradation process of the active ingredients, ensuring that the medication remains effective throughout its shelf life.

Heat Sensitivity and Stability

Semaglutide, like other peptide-based medications, is sensitive to heat. Exposure to high temperatures can cause the peptide chains to degrade, leading to a loss of potency or even the formation of harmful by-products. The storage in a refrigerated environment is a precautionary measure to prevent such degradation, ensuring that the medication remains stable and retains its therapeutic efficacy. It is essential for patients and healthcare professionals to adhere to the recommended storage conditions to ensure the quality of the medication.

Handling Semaglutide

Proper handling of semaglutide is as important as its storage. Once the medication is removed from the refrigerator, it should be administered promptly or stored at room temperature (below 30°C or 86°F) for a limited period, as specified by the manufacturer. It is crucial to avoid exposing semaglutide to extreme temperatures, such as leaving it in a hot car or on a sunny windowsill, as this can compromise its effectiveness.

Traveling with Semaglutide

For individuals who need to travel with semaglutide, especially over long distances or to areas with significant temperature variations, planning is essential. A portable cooler with ice packs can be used to keep the medication refrigerated during travel. However, it is vital to check the airline’s or transportation provider’s policy regarding the carriage of refrigerated medications and to pack the medication in accordance with these guidelines. Additionally, carrying a letter from a healthcare provider explaining the medication’s requirements can be helpful in case of questions or security checks.

Emergency Situations

In situations where semaglutide is inadvertently exposed to temperatures outside the recommended range, it is essential to use judgment regarding its use. If the medication has been at room temperature for a period exceeding the manufacturer’s guidelines or has been exposed to freezing temperatures, it should not be used. In such cases, patients should consult their healthcare provider or pharmacist for advice on whether the medication is still safe to use or if a replacement is needed.

Can Semaglutide be Exposed to Room Temperature, and for How Long?

Exposure of semaglutide to room temperature is generally allowed but only for a limited period. According to the manufacturer’s guidelines, semaglutide pens or prefilled syringes that have been removed from the refrigerator can be stored at room temperature (up to 30°C or 86°F) for a specified number of days. This flexibility is useful for travel or when the medication is being used and needs to be carried. However, it’s critical to adhere to the recommended duration to avoid compromising the medication’s potency.

It is essential to consult the packaging or the manufacturer’s instructions for the exact number of days semaglutide can be safely stored at room temperature. Generally, this can range from a few days to a couple of weeks, depending on the product formulation. After this period, if not used, the medication should be discarded, regardless of whether it looks or seems effective. Maintaining a strict temperature control helps ensure that semaglutide performs as intended, providing the best therapeutic outcomes for patients.

What Happens if Semaglutide is Frozen Accidentally?

If semaglutide is frozen accidentally, it’s crucial to understand that freezing can permanently damage the medication. Freezing causes the active ingredients to degrade, which may lead to a loss of potency or even make the medication ineffective. The medication’s efficacy cannot be guaranteed after freezing, and using degraded semaglutide could result in reduced therapeutic effects, potentially leading to poor blood sugar control or less effective weight management.

In the event that semaglutide is accidentally frozen, it’s recommended to discard the medication and replace it with a new, properly stored supply. Patients should consult their healthcare provider or pharmacist for guidance on obtaining a replacement and to discuss any concerns about the potential impact on their treatment plan. It’s also an opportunity to review proper storage and handling procedures to prevent such incidents in the future, ensuring continuous and effective treatment.

Can I Store Semaglutide in a Freezer to Keep it Cooler?

No, it is not recommended to store semaglutide in a freezer. The medication is specifically designed to be refrigerated at a temperature range between 2°C and 8°C (36°F and 46°F), and freezing is not a safe or recommended storage condition. Freezing temperatures can cause the medication to degrade, altering its chemical structure and potentially rendering it ineffective. Furthermore, freezing could also lead to physical changes in the formulation, such as the separation of ingredients or the formation of ice crystals, which could affect the delivery of the medication.

Storing semaglutide in a freezer is a common mistake that can be avoided by carefully reading and following the storage instructions provided with the medication or consulting with a healthcare professional. It’s also important to note that refrigeration, not freezing, is the standard for storing most biological medications like semaglutide. By adhering to the recommended storage conditions, patients can ensure they receive the full therapeutic benefit of their medication and minimize the risk of adverse effects or reduced efficacy.
